There is no real way to test your websites real speed because what you test on is going to be very different from what the end user is going to be using. Using websites to analyze your website for improvements is not really helpful because they load your website on there server which has a faster connection then yours and then guess how it might load on a slower connection.

The best tool's are already built in your browser if you are using a modern one. Just turn on developer mode and look at the inspector. Typically there will be a tab called resources and that will show every object on a web page and how long it took to download and process those files. Doing tweaks based on whats in there is a good thing and will improve your sites speed. But then again it's only based on how your computer loaded the page. If someone goes to your site with slower computer and older browser it will load much slower.

Many other things can come into play on your websites "real" speed like what type of web server you run, how far you are from the server, the servers load, etc. etc.

There is no way to know a websites "real" speed, because what it is for you, it will be different for another person.
